Artificial intelligence (AI) has made remarkable strides over the past few decades, transforming various aspects of our lives from healthcare to entertainment. Traditionally, AI development has heavily relied on human intervention for training, fine-tuning, and improving algorithms. However, the landscape is rapidly changing with the advent of self-evolving AI systems. These AI models can evolve and improve without direct human input, a concept often referred to as "Auto Evol-Instruct." This revolutionary approach is pushing the boundaries of what AI can achieve, offering potential solutions to some of the most complex problems in various fields.
In this article, we will delve deep into the concept of Auto Evol-Instruct, exploring how AI is learning to evolve autonomously. We will cover the underlying technologies, real-world applications, ethical considerations, and the future potential of self-evolving AI.
The Evolution of AI: From Human-Driven to Self-Evolving
Traditional AI Development
Traditional AI development involves several key steps that require human intervention:
- Data Collection: Gathering relevant data to train the AI model.
- Data Preprocessing: Cleaning and organizing the data for training.
- Model Selection: Choosing the appropriate algorithm for the task.
- Training: Feeding the data into the model and adjusting parameters.
- Evaluation: Assessing the model's performance and making necessary adjustments.
- Deployment and Monitoring: Implementing the model in a real-world environment and continually monitoring its performance.
Each of these steps involves significant human effort, expertise, and time. However, advancements in AI research are paving the way for systems that can handle many of these processes independently.
The Emergence of AutoML
Automated Machine Learning (AutoML) is a precursor to fully self-evolving AI. AutoML aims to automate the end-to-end process of applying machine learning to real-world problems. It simplifies the development process, making it accessible to non-experts and enabling rapid experimentation.
Key components of AutoML include:
- Automated Data Preprocessing: Automatically cleaning and preparing data.
- Automated Feature Engineering: Identifying and creating relevant features from raw data.
- Automated Model Selection: Choosing the best model architecture for the task.
- Hyperparameter Optimization: Automatically tuning model parameters to achieve optimal performance.
- Model Evaluation and Selection: Comparing models and selecting the best one based on performance metrics.
While AutoML significantly reduces the need for human intervention, it still requires initial setup and oversight. The next step in the evolution of AI is creating systems that can evolve and improve entirely on their own.
The Concept of Auto Evol-Instruct
Auto Evol-Instruct refers to AI systems that can learn, adapt, and evolve without human intervention. These systems use a combination of evolutionary algorithms, reinforcement learning, and unsupervised learning to continuously improve their performance.
Key Technologies Enabling Auto Evol-Instruct
- Evolutionary Algorithms: These algorithms mimic the process of natural selection to evolve AI models. They start with a population of candidate solutions and iteratively select, mutate, and recombine them to produce better solutions. Over time, the population evolves to become more effective at the given task.
- Reinforcement Learning (RL): RL involves training an AI agent to make decisions by rewarding desired behaviors and penalizing undesired ones. The agent learns through trial and error, gradually improving its performance. When combined with evolutionary algorithms, RL can help AI systems adapt to new environments and tasks autonomously.
- Unsupervised Learning: Unlike supervised learning, which requires labeled data, unsupervised learning algorithms identify patterns and structures in unlabeled data. This capability allows AI systems to discover new insights and adapt without needing explicit guidance.
- Neuroevolution: This approach involves evolving neural networks using evolutionary algorithms. It enables the discovery of novel network architectures and hyperparameters, leading to more efficient and powerful AI models.
How Auto Evol-Instruct Works
Auto Evol-Instruct systems operate in a cycle of continuous improvement:
- Initialization: The system begins with a diverse population of AI models or algorithms.
- Evaluation: Each candidate is evaluated based on its performance on the given task.
- Selection: The best-performing candidates are selected to form the next generation.
- Variation: New candidates are generated through mutation (random changes) and recombination (combining parts of different candidates).
- Iteration: The cycle repeats, with each generation ideally performing better than the previous one.
Over time, the system evolves to become more proficient at the task, discovering new strategies and solutions without human intervention.
Real-World Applications of Auto Evol-Instruct
The potential applications of self-evolving AI are vast and varied. Here are some examples of how this technology is being used and could be used in the future:
Healthcare
- Drug Discovery: Auto Evol-Instruct systems can analyze vast datasets of chemical compounds and biological interactions to identify potential new drugs. By continuously evolving, these systems can discover novel treatments more efficiently than traditional methods.
- Personalized Medicine: Self-evolving AI can tailor treatments to individual patients based on their genetic makeup, medical history, and lifestyle. This approach can lead to more effective and personalized healthcare solutions.
- Medical Imaging: Evolving AI algorithms can improve the accuracy and efficiency of medical imaging analysis, aiding in early diagnosis and treatment of diseases like cancer.
Finance
- Algorithmic Trading: In the financial sector, self-evolving AI can develop and refine trading algorithms that adapt to changing market conditions, potentially leading to higher returns and reduced risk.
- Fraud Detection: Evolving AI systems can continuously improve their ability to detect fraudulent activities by learning from new data and adapting to emerging fraud patterns.
- Risk Management: Financial institutions can use self-evolving AI to better assess and manage risk by analyzing complex datasets and identifying potential threats.
Autonomous Systems
- Self-Driving Cars: Auto Evol-Instruct technology can enhance the capabilities of autonomous vehicles by enabling them to learn from real-world driving experiences and adapt to new environments and situations.
- Drones and Robotics: Evolving AI can improve the performance of drones and robots in various applications, from agriculture to disaster response, by enabling them to adapt to dynamic conditions and optimize their actions.
Climate and Environmental Science
- Climate Modeling: Self-evolving AI can improve the accuracy of climate models by continuously learning from new data and refining predictions about climate change and its impacts.
- Environmental Monitoring: Evolving AI systems can analyze data from sensors and satellites to monitor environmental changes and predict natural disasters, helping to mitigate their effects.
- Sustainable Practices: AI can optimize resource usage in agriculture, energy production, and other industries, promoting sustainability and reducing environmental impact.
Education
- Personalized Learning: Self-evolving AI can create customized learning experiences for students, adapting to their individual needs and learning styles to improve educational outcomes.
- Tutoring and Assistance: Evolving AI tutors can provide one-on-one instruction and support in various subjects, helping students achieve their academic goals.
- Educational Content Creation: AI can generate and update educational materials, ensuring that they remain current and relevant.
Ethical and Practical Considerations
While the potential benefits of Auto Evol-Instruct are immense, there are several ethical and practical considerations that must be addressed:
Transparency and Explainability
As AI systems become more autonomous, it is crucial to ensure that their decision-making processes are transparent and explainable. This is particularly important in high-stakes applications like healthcare and finance, where decisions can have significant consequences.
Bias and Fairness
Self-evolving AI systems can inadvertently perpetuate or exacerbate biases present in the data they are trained on. It is essential to develop strategies to identify and mitigate bias, ensuring that AI systems are fair and equitable.
Accountability
As AI systems take on more responsibilities, determining accountability becomes more complex. Clear guidelines and frameworks are needed to ensure that developers, operators, and users of AI systems are held accountable for their actions.
Security
Evolving AI systems must be designed with robust security measures to prevent malicious attacks and unauthorized access. Ensuring the security of these systems is critical to maintaining trust and preventing misuse.
Ethical Use
The ethical implications of self-evolving AI must be carefully considered. This includes ensuring that AI systems are used for beneficial purposes and do not cause harm to individuals or society.
The Future of Auto Evol-Instruct
The future of Auto Evol-Instruct is both exciting and uncertain. As AI technology continues to advance, self-evolving AI systems have the potential to revolutionize various industries and improve our lives in countless ways. However, realizing this potential will require addressing the ethical, practical, and technical challenges that come with autonomous AI.
Research and Development
Ongoing research in AI and related fields will be crucial to advancing Auto Evol-Instruct technology. This includes developing more sophisticated evolutionary algorithms, improving reinforcement learning techniques, and exploring new approaches to unsupervised learning.
Collaboration
Collaboration between researchers, industry, policymakers, and the public will be essential to ensure that self-evolving AI is developed and deployed responsibly. This includes sharing knowledge, resources, and best practices to address common challenges and achieve shared goals.
Education and Awareness
Raising awareness and understanding of Auto Evol-Instruct technology is crucial to fostering public trust and engagement. This includes educating people about the benefits and risks of self-evolving AI and promoting informed discussions about its future.
Regulation and Governance
Developing appropriate regulatory frameworks and governance structures will be essential to ensure that self-evolving AI is used safely and ethically. This includes establishing standards, guidelines, and oversight mechanisms to address issues like transparency, bias, accountability, and security.
Conclusion
Auto Evol-Instruct represents a significant leap forward in the evolution of artificial intelligence. By enabling AI systems to learn, adapt, and improve without human intervention, this technology has the potential to revolutionize various industries and solve some of the most complex challenges we face.
However, realizing the full potential of Auto Evol-Instruct will require careful consideration of the ethical, practical, and technical challenges that come with autonomous AI. By addressing these challenges and fostering collaboration, education, and responsible development, we can harness the power of self-evolving AI to create a better future for all.
As we stand on the brink of this exciting new frontier, it is up to us to ensure that the development and deployment of Auto Evol-Instruct technology are guided by principles of fairness, transparency, and accountability. By doing so, we can unlock the full potential of self-evolving AI and pave the way for a brighter, more innovative future.
Stay Updated with Our Newsletter
Sign up to receive the latest articles, insights, and trends.